Modeling and experimental research on zero-bias thermal stability of the torque motor for aviation electro-hydraulic servo valves

A permanent magnet torque motor’s (PMTM) zero is very easily shifted under the dual thermal changes of structure and material in a high-temperature service environment. The aero-engine electro-hydraulic servo valve’s service performance is greatly ...
